For how long does it require to board up a window?
The time can differ depending on the number of windows and the experience of the person performing the task. Generally, each window may take between 15 minutes to an hour.
2. What kind of plywood should I utilize?
For a lot of emergency situations, 1/2 inch plywood suffices for standard windows. For larger or more susceptible windows, 3/4 inch plywood might be better suited.
3. Can I board up windows by myself?
Yes, boarding up windows can be done alone, however it is recommended to have someone assist you for safety and effectiveness, particularly for larger panels.
4. Is there a way to prevent requiring window board-up?
Installing storm shutters, using safety movie on windows, and guaranteeing routine upkeep can all help in reducing the need for emergency board-ups.
5. Can I reuse plywood after boarding up?
If effectively stored and if no substantial damage has actually happened, plywood can frequently be recycled for future emergency situations. Always inspect it for rot or fractures before reinstallation.
